To continue the ÿÈÕ´óÈüÍøÕ¾ commitment to provide programs that support the community, the Associate of Arts degree program in General Education serves to recognize academic achievement and establish a milestone in a student’s learning trajectory—whether as the first half of a bachelor’s degree or as a standalone two-year degree.

The Associate of Arts degree

  • Validates the hard work and dedication of ÿÈÕ´óÈüÍøÕ¾ students.
  • Provides a strong foundation in the core competencies of the ÿÈÕ´óÈüÍøÕ¾ Core, including Critical Inquiry, Effective Communication, Responsible Living, and Diversity.
  • Is fully transferable to other Arkansas institutions of higher education, and, thus, provides credit hours that may be applied toward a baccalaureate degree at ÿÈÕ´óÈüÍøÕ¾ or at another institution of higher education.

[1] Degree Requirements

The Associate of Arts in General Education (AA) requires completion of the lower-division ÿÈÕ´óÈüÍøÕ¾ Core (38 hours) and at least 22 hours of elective courses (see below) for a total of 60 credit hours.

For general degree requirements, including the residence credit requirement, see Degree Requirements, § 1.

[1.1] Lower-Division ÿÈÕ´óÈüÍøÕ¾ Core (38 hours)

Completion of the lower-division ÿÈÕ´óÈüÍøÕ¾ Core satisfies the Arkansas State Minimum Core general education requirement (35 hours) plus three elective hours. See LD ÿÈÕ´óÈüÍøÕ¾ Core for specific requirements.

[1.2] Directed Electives (15–22)

Electives not taken in fulfillment of the ÿÈÕ´óÈüÍøÕ¾ Core, chosen from lower-division courses with the following course prefixes: ANTH, ART, BIOL, CHEM, COMM, CRWR, CSCI, ECON, ENGL, FREN, GEOG, GERM, HIST, MATH, MUS, PHIL, PHYS, PSCI, PSYC, SOC, SPAN, THEA, WRTG.

[1.3] Institutional Requirements/Approved Electives (0–7)

Electives chosen in consultation with the student’s academic advisor.
